I have the k-30 antenna mag mount and also the k-40 but I use the k-30 since it's smaller and don't look as silly but anyways I run it under my floor mats and the seats to the rear slider window and it's mag mounted in the center of my roof. Works great there and no coax is showing or gives an issues with the rear window.

Depending on the brand antenna you can usually twist the antenna part off and throw it in the truck if your worried about people taking it.

I've got the Cobra 85, so it uses a remote box I mounted under the driver seat. Mic hangs on the dash, and I used a 3' firestik mounted on the 3rd brake light lightbar. Only time I use it though is when off road with a group. It works great for that, just doesn't get much use.
